Selective 5–HT4 agonist useful in gastroesophageal reflux disease and lacking arrhythmogenic property is :

Correct Answer: Tegaserod
Description: Both cisapride and tegaserod are selective 5HT4 agonists useful in the treatment of GERD. Cisapride possesses cardiac K+ channel blocking activity and can lead to torsades de pointes. Tegaserod is devoid of this adverse effect. However, tegaserod has recently been withdrawn due to an increased risk of MI and stroke.
